Default EQ and Win8.1 64-bit?

sup everyone.

upgraded to said OS, copied my EQ folder over and it wouldn't work due to all kinds of different settings. installed a fresh titanium client, followed the setup guide to the letter, but it keeps crashing on the loading screen after server select (like 10% into the loading process). spews out some memory error and that's it. tried wineq, but it doesn't fix it - windowed mode enabled and all.

has anyone else had this issue?
